Unspoilt by commercialism, once there, there are no lifeguards, shops, and usua [more] [sue51, 30/10/2006] Situated on the South Side of the Gower Peninsula, the UK's first designated area of outstanding natural beauty, Three Cliffs Bay, (known locally as Three Cliffs) is around 10 miles from the modern vibrant City and County of Swansea.
Getting to Three Cliffs is not for the faint-hearted; whichever aspect you approach it from, involves long walks through sandy paths or weatherworn hill walks. Unspoilt by commercialism, once there, there are no lifeguards, shops, and usually very few people; swimming here can be dangerous at times because of strong undercurrents and cross tides.
Nevertheless, if you are fit and able, then Three Cliffs, recently identified on BBC as the best beach in the UK, and in Country Life magazine as the best place iin Britain to see the sunset, then, if you are in the area and able, you really shouldn't leave without seeing this amazing sight.
